Most expensive spells in IPL finals

The Indian Premier League has witnessed several players rise to the occasion in big matches for their respective sides. However, sometimes the occasion gets the better of the players, making for a horrendous viewing for the spectators. On that note, we list the most expensive spells in the finals of IPL history.

3) 54 – Karanveer Singh (Kings XI Punjab) against Kolkata Knight Riders, 2014

Kings XI Punjab (now Punjab Kings) posted a daunting total on the board in the 2014 IPL final against Kolkata Knight Riders on the back of a trailblazing century from Wriddhiman Saha. However, the Kolkata-based franchise scripted a sensational chase on the back of Manish Pandey’s scathing assault. While several Punjab bowlers took a beating that night, Karanveer Singh had a nightmare outing, conceding 54 runs in his four overs.

2) 56 – Tushar Deshpande (CSK), 2023 and Lockie Ferguson (KKR), 2021

Chennai Super Kings unearthed a talented fast bowler in Tushar Deshpande, who improved drastically in the 16th edition of the IPL. However, the express pacer had a knack for going for plenty of runs, something that almost cost his side in the final of IPL 2023. His poor outing with the ball saw him concede 56 runs in his four overs without a solitary wicket to his name.

Kiwi speedster Lockie Ferguson has also a tendency to lose his radar in crucial matches, and his erratic performance for Kolkata Knight Riders cost them the IPL 2021 final against Chennai Super Kings. He conceded 56 runs in his four overs, without taking a single wicket to aid CSK batters in putting up a match-winning total on the board.

1) 61 – Shane Watson (RCB) against SRH, 2016

Former Australian all-rounder Shane Watson has played several memorable innings with the bat in IPL history but the beloved Aussie won’t be looking back at his stint with RCB, especially the 2016 final, too fondly. He found himself in the history books for the wrong reasons as he conceded the most runs by any bowler in the final of the tournament, leaving 61 runs against Sunrisers Hyderabad in a forgettable night at the Chinnaswamy.
